Background technology:
Automobile Triangular Arm assembly, mainly bear turning to and supporting role of suspension system, Triangular Arm assembly is one of parts of paramount importance in suspension system, it mainly plays support, transmitted load, control the steering-effecting in wheel trace and vehicle traveling process, to the road-holding property of vehicle, riding comfort, ride comfort and safety rise makes key role.
Ball joint on Triangular Arm is connected with steering swivel, and the rubber bush on Triangular Arm is connected with vehicle frame.After Triangular Arm entrucking, along with the running car time increases, various road conditions can be run into, vehicle is impacted, jolt and the impact of side force that automobile is subject to when turning, from wheel impulsive force and vibration by ball joint along Triangular Arm to vehicle body transmission, Triangular Arm is constantly drawn, compressive load and impact loading, along with the growth of period of service, the performance of rubber bush can reduce gradually, triangle arm rubber lining and vehicle frame connection place can be made to produce under greater impact load collide, send Abnormal Sound, particularly send Abnormal Sound during automobile turning, affect normal driving and the traffic safety of chaufeur, travelling comfort is reduced greatly.So have damping, eliminate the automobile Triangular Arm assembly of abnormal sound function to vehicle handling stability, travelling comfort and driving safety play an important role.
Utility model content:
The purpose of this utility model is to solve the problem, and proposes a kind of automobile Triangular Arm with shock-absorbing function, and this automobile Triangular Arm with shock-absorbing function has the evident characteristic of design science, rational in infrastructure, damping and elimination abnormal sound.
In order to solve the problem, the utility model provides a kind of technical scheme: a kind of automobile Triangular Arm with shock-absorbing function, comprises ball joint, Triangular Arm body, rubber bush one, rubber bush two, yielding rubber pad and steering swivel; The concrete structure of described Triangular Arm body is: comprise body, head, the first afterbody and the second afterbody; The surrounding of described body has head, the first afterbody and the second afterbody with the mode global formation of center of circle array; The head of described Triangular Arm body has been bolted to connection ball joint; Described ball joint is connected with steering swivel; Rubber bush one is connected with in the suspension fixed orifice preset in first afterbody of described Triangular Arm body; Rubber bush two is connected with in the suspension fixed orifice preset in second afterbody of described Triangular Arm body; The both sides of described rubber bush two are also respectively equipped with yielding rubber pad.
As preferably, described yielding rubber pad is toroidal.
The beneficial effects of the utility model: its reasonable in design, modern design is unique, the both sides of rubber bush two add yielding rubber pad respectively, automobile is in the process of moving when being subject to greater impact load, yielding rubber pad serves function of shock insulation, prevent Triangular Arm and vehicle frame from colliding, eliminate the factor producing abnormal sound, also prevent the vibrations of wheel to vehicle frame transmission simultaneously, achieve damping, eliminate the function of abnormal sound, ride comfort is improved greatly, and driving becomes more controlled and safety.
